简体   繁体   English

如何拆分字符串并从中获取字符?

[英]How to split string and take characters from it?

Have next lines: 下一行:

var line1 = File.ReadLines(@"input_5_5.txt").Take(1).ToArray();
string[] u = line1.Split(new Char[] { ' ' });
int[,] result = new int[u[0], u[1]];

Need to split and take characters from line1 to initialize size of array but it runs error about word "Split". 需要拆分并从第1行中提取字符以初始化数组的大小,但它会出现有关单词“ Split”的错误。

line1 is an array. line1是一个数组。

You need to cast it to string: 您需要将其强制转换为字符串:

(line1[0] as String).Split(...

or simply 或简单地

line1[0].Split(...

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M